Top 5 Adventure Games on Unified Platform in Switzerland - Q3 2021
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 adventure games in Switzerland during Q3 2021,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the third quarter of 2021, the adventure gaming landscape in Switzerland saw notable performances from the top 5 apps across both iOS and Android platforms. Below, we delve into the trends observed in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users for these leading titles.
Genshin Impact: Natlan Launch
From COGNOSPHERE PTE. LTD., this app showed significant fluctuations in weekly revenue. The highest revenue was recorded at approximately $537K during the week of August 30. Weekly downloads peaked at 3.3K in mid-July, and weekly active users consistently hovered around the 14K to 18K range, peaking at 18.1K in early September.
Summoners War
Published by Com2uS Corp., this app exhibited a stable performance. Weekly revenue varied, peaking at $48.4K at the end of June. Weekly downloads reached their highest at 123 in early September. Active users showed a steady trend, with numbers around 4.2K to 4.9K, peaking at 4.8K in mid-September.
King's Throne
Goat Co. Ltd’s game experienced moderate revenue trends, with a peak of $24.5K in mid-July. Weekly downloads saw a high of 1K in early July and mid-August. Active users showed a significant increase early in the quarter, reaching 4.4K, and then stabilizing around 3.8K to 4.1K towards the end of September.
The Seven Deadly Sins
Released by Netmarble Corporation, this game had its highest revenue of $34.7K in late June. Weekly downloads were highest at 529 in mid-July, while active users peaked at nearly 4.6K during the same period, showing a consistent user base throughout the quarter.
Guardians of Cloudia
This title by NEOCRAFT LIMITED saw its weekly revenue peak at $15.1K in the last week of September. Weekly downloads were highest at 772 at the end of June. Active user numbers started at 1.1K and saw a decline, stabilizing around 500 towards the end of the quarter.
